Problem after upgra...
 
Notifications
Clear all

Problem after upgrade to 23.11.0

4 Posts
2 Users
0 Reactions
10.6 K Views
 dart
(@dart)
Joined: 1 year ago
Posts: 11
Topic starter  

Hello!,

If anybody have a problem with GUI webmail / admin panel after upgrade Carbonio from 23.10.0 to 23.11.0? I do everything following the https://docs.zextras.com/carbonio/html/release/upgrade.html but after all and restart Carbonio it looks like:

 

So, it's almost empty and you can't do anything.

In logs, after refresh URLs I have f.e:

lusterLoadAssignment
lis 26 14:06:47 poczta.XXXXXXXXXXX consul[7593]: [2023-11-26 14:06:47.140][7593][info][upstream] [source/server/lds_api.cc:78] lds: add/update listener 'public_listener:0.0.0.0:21013'
lis 26 14:06:50 poczta.XXXXXXXXXXX carbonio-preview-start.sh[2035]: "[2023-11-26 14:06:50,110] INFO [uvicorn.access.send:478] 127.0.0.1:54700 - "GET /health/ready/ HTTP/1.1" 200"
lis 26 14:06:54 poczta.XXXXXXXXXXX prometheus[1254]: ts=2023-11-26T13:06:54.046Z caller=consul.go:295 level=error component="discovery manager scrape" discovery=consul config=process msg="Error retrieving datacenter name" err="Unexpected 
response code: 403 (Permission denied)"
lis 26 14:06:55 poczta.XXXXXXXXXXX carbonio-preview-start.sh[2030]: "[2023-11-26 14:06:55,113] INFO [uvicorn.access.send:478] 127.0.0.1:54710 - "GET /health/ready/ HTTP/1.1" 200"
lis 26 14:06:55 poczta.XXXXXXXXXXX consul[7601]: [2023-11-26 14:06:55.623][7601][warning][config] [source/common/config/grpc_subscription_impl.cc:119] gRPC config: initial fetch timed out for type.googleapis.com/envoy.config.endpoint.v3.C
lusterLoadAssignment
lis 26 14:06:55 poczta.XXXXXXXXXXX consul[7601]: [2023-11-26 14:06:55.623][7601][warning][config] [source/common/config/grpc_subscription_impl.cc:119] gRPC config: initial fetch timed out for type.googleapis.com/envoy.config.endpoint.v3.C
lusterLoadAssignment
lis 26 14:06:55 poczta.XXXXXXXXXXX consul[7601]: [2023-11-26 14:06:55.629][7601][info][upstream] [source/server/lds_api.cc:78] lds: add/update listener 'public_listener:0.0.0.0:21008'
lis 26 14:07:00 poczta.XXXXXXXXXXX carbonio-preview-start.sh[2035]: "[2023-11-26 14:07:00,115] INFO [uvicorn.access.send:478] 127.0.0.1:35028 - "GET /health/ready/ HTTP/1.1" 200"
lis 26 14:07:02 poczta.XXXXXXXXXXX carbonio-files[12542]: 14:07:02.412 [Xmemcached-Reactor-0] ERROR remoting - Reactor dispatch events error
lis 26 14:07:02 poczta.XXXXXXXXXXX carbonio-files[12542]: java.io.IOException: Connect to 10.0.60.24:11211 fail,Connection refused
lis 26 14:07:02 poczta.XXXXXXXXXXX carbonio-files[12542]:         at net.rubyeye.xmemcached.impl.MemcachedConnector.onConnect(MemcachedConnector.java:426)
lis 26 14:07:02 poczta.XXXXXXXXXXX carbonio-files[12542]:         at com.google.code.yanf4j.nio.impl.Reactor.dispatchEvent(Reactor.java:317)
lis 26 14:07:02 poczta.XXXXXXXXXXX carbonio-files[12542]:         at com.google.code.yanf4j.nio.impl.Reactor.run(Reactor.java:177)
lis 26 14:07:05 poczta.XXXXXXXXXXX carbonio-preview-start.sh[2030]: "[2023-11-26 14:07:05,117] INFO [uvicorn.access.send:478] 127.0.0.1:35030 - "GET /health/ready/ HTTP/1.1" 200"
lis 26 14:07:09 poczta.XXXXXXXXXXX prometheus[1254]: ts=2023-11-26T13:07:09.047Z caller=consul.go:295 level=error component="discovery manager scrape" discovery=consul config=process msg="Error retrieving datacenter name" err="Unexpected 
response code: 403 (Permission denied)"
lis 26 14:07:10 poczta.XXXXXXXXXXX carbonio-preview-start.sh[2030]: "[2023-11-26 14:07:10,120] INFO [uvicorn.access.send:478] 127.0.0.1:42502 - "GET /health/ready/ HTTP/1.1" 200"
lis 26 14:07:15 poczta.XXXXXXXXXXX carbonio-preview-start.sh[2030]: "[2023-11-26 14:07:15,122] INFO [uvicorn.access.send:478] 127.0.0.1:42516 - "GET /health/ready/ HTTP/1.1" 200"
lis 26 14:07:20 poczta.XXXXXXXXXXX carbonio-preview-start.sh[2035]: "[2023-11-26 14:07:20,124] INFO [uvicorn.access.send:478] 127.0.0.1:51398 - "GET /health/ready/ HTTP/1.1" 200"
lis 26 14:07:24 poczta.XXXXXXXXXXX prometheus[1254]: ts=2023-11-26T13:07:24.048Z caller=consul.go:295 level=error component="discovery manager scrape" discovery=consul config=process msg="Error retrieving datacenter name" err="Unexpected 
response code: 403 (Permission denied)"
lis 26 14:07:25 poczta.XXXXXXXXXXX carbonio-preview-start.sh[2035]: "[2023-11-26 14:07:25,127] INFO [uvicorn.access.send:478] 127.0.0.1:51404 - "GET /health/ready/ HTTP/1.1" 200"
lis 26 14:07:30 poczta.XXXXXXXXXXX carbonio-preview-start.sh[2035]: "[2023-11-26 14:07:30,129] INFO [uvicorn.access.send:478] 127.0.0.1:53696 - "GET /health/ready/ HTTP/1.1" 200"
lis 26 14:07:35 poczta.XXXXXXXXXXX carbonio-preview-start.sh[2035]: "[2023-11-26 14:07:35,131] INFO [uvicorn.access.send:478] 127.0.0.1:53706 - "GET /health/ready/ HTTP/1.1" 200"
lis 26 14:07:39 poczta.XXXXXXXXXXX prometheus[1254]: ts=2023-11-26T13:07:39.049Z caller=consul.go:295 level=error component="discovery manager scrape" discovery=consul config=process msg="Error retrieving datacenter name" err="Unexpected 
response code: 403 (Permission denied)"
lis 26 14:07:40 poczta.XXXXXXXXXXX carbonio-preview-start.sh[2035]: "[2023-11-26 14:07:40,133] INFO [uvicorn.access.send:478] 127.0.0.1:60178 - "GET /health/ready/ HTTP/1.1" 200"
lis 26 14:07:45 poczta.XXXXXXXXXXX carbonio-preview-start.sh[2035]: "[2023-11-26 14:07:45,136] INFO [uvicorn.access.send:478] 127.0.0.1:60186 - "GET /health/ready/ HTTP/1.1" 200"
lis 26 14:07:50 poczta.XXXXXXXXXXX carbonio-preview-start.sh[2035]: "[2023-11-26 14:07:50,139] INFO [uvicorn.access.send:478] 127.0.0.1:48892 - "GET /health/ready/ HTTP/1.1" 200"
lis 26 14:07:54 poczta.XXXXXXXXXXX prometheus[1254]: ts=2023-11-26T13:07:54.050Z caller=consul.go:295 level=error component="discovery manager scrape" discovery=consul config=process msg="Error retrieving datacenter name" err="Unexpected 
response code: 403 (Permission denied)"
lis 26 14:07:55 poczta.XXXXXXXXXXX carbonio-preview-start.sh[2035]: "[2023-11-26 14:07:55,142] INFO [uvicorn.access.send:478] 127.0.0.1:48900 - "GET /health/ready/ HTTP/1.1" 200"
lis 26 14:08:00 poczta.XXXXXXXXXXX carbonio-preview-start.sh[2035]: "[2023-11-26 14:08:00,145] INFO [uvicorn.access.send:478] 127.0.0.1:38096 - "GET /health/ready/ HTTP/1.1" 200"
lis 26 14:08:02 poczta.XXXXXXXXXXX carbonio-files[12542]: 14:08:02.413 [Xmemcached-Reactor-0] ERROR remoting - Reactor dispatch events error
lis 26 14:08:02 poczta.XXXXXXXXXXX carbonio-files[12542]: java.io.IOException: Connect to 10.0.60.24:11211 fail,Connection refused
lis 26 14:08:02 poczta.XXXXXXXXXXX carbonio-files[12542]:         at net.rubyeye.xmemcached.impl.MemcachedConnector.onConnect(MemcachedConnector.java:426)
lis 26 14:08:02 poczta.XXXXXXXXXXX carbonio-files[12542]:         at com.google.code.yanf4j.nio.impl.Reactor.dispatchEvent(Reactor.java:317)
lis 26 14:08:02 poczta.XXXXXXXXXXX carbonio-files[12542]:         at com.google.code.yanf4j.nio.impl.Reactor.run(Reactor.java:177)
lis 26 14:08:05 poczta.XXXXXXXXXXX carbonio-preview-start.sh[2030]: "[2023-11-26 14:08:05,154] INFO [uvicorn.access.send:478] 127.0.0.1:38108 - "GET /health/ready/ HTTP/1.1" 200"
lis 26 14:08:09 poczta.XXXXXXXXXXX prometheus[1254]: ts=2023-11-26T13:08:09.051Z caller=consul.go:295 level=error component="discovery manager scrape" discovery=consul config=process msg="Error retrieving datacenter name" err="Unexpected 
response code: 403 (Permission denied)"
lis 26 14:08:10 poczta.XXXXXXXXXXX carbonio-preview-start.sh[2035]: "[2023-11-26 14:08:10,161] INFO [uvicorn.access.send:478] 127.0.0.1:45970 - "GET /health/ready/ HTTP/1.1" 200"
lis 26 14:08:14 poczta.XXXXXXXXXXX consul[7569]: [2023-11-26 14:08:14.734][7569][warning][config] [bazel-out/k8-opt/bin/source/common/config/_virtual_includes/grpc_stream_lib/common/config/grpc_stream.h:101] DeltaAggregatedResources gRPC 
config stream closed: 13,
lis 26 14:08:14 poczta.XXXXXXXXXXX consul[7601]: [2023

.......

lis 26 14:08:14 poczta.XXXXXXXXXXX consul[7620]: [2023-11-26 14:08:14.735][7620][warning][config] [bazel-out/k8-opt/bin/source/common/config/_virtual_includes/grpc_stream_lib/common/config/grpc_stream.h:101] DeltaAggregatedResources gRPC config stream closed: 13,
lis 26 14:08:14 poczta.XXXXXXXXXXX prometheus[1254]: ts=2023-11-26T13:08:14.736Z caller=consul.go:522 level=error component="discovery manager scrape" discovery=consul config=blackbox datacenter=dc1 msg="Error refreshing service" service=carbonio-user-management-sidecar-proxy tags= err="Unexpected response code: 500 (rpc error: code = Canceled desc = grpc: the client connection is closing)"
lis 26 14:08:14 poczta.XXXXXXXXXXX prometheus[1254]: ts=2023-11-26T13:08:14.736Z caller=consul.go:522 level=error component="discovery manager scrape" discovery=consul config=blackbox datacenter=dc1 msg="Error refreshing service" service=carbonio-mailbox-sidecar-proxy tags= err="Unexpected response code: 500 (rpc error: code = Canceled desc = grpc: the client connection is closing)"
lis 26 14:08:14 poczta.XXXXXXXXXXX prometheus[1254]: ts=2023-11-26T13:08:14.736Z caller=consul.go:522 level=error component="discovery manager scrape" discovery=consul config=blackbox datacenter=dc1 msg="Error refreshing service" service=carbonio-files-sidecar-proxy tags= err="Unexpected response code: 500 (rpc error: code = Canceled desc = grpc: the client connection is closing)"
lis 26 14:08:14 poczta.XXXXXXXXXXX prometheus[1254]: ts=2023-11-26T13:08:14.736Z caller=consul.go:522 level=error component="discovery manager scrape" discovery=consul config=blackbox datacenter=dc1 msg="Error refreshing service" service=carbonio-files-db-sidecar-proxy tags= err="Unexpected response code: 500 (rpc error: code = Canceled desc = grpc: the client connection is closing)"
lis 26 14:08:14 poczta.XXXXXXXXXXX prometheus[1254]: ts=2023-11-26T13:08:14.736Z caller=consul.go:522 level=error component="discovery manager scrape" discovery=consul config=blackbox datacenter=dc1 msg="Error refreshing service" service=carbonio-mta-sidecar-proxy tags= err="Unexpected response code: 500 (rpc error: code = Canceled desc = grpc: the client connection is closing)"
lis 26 14:08:14 poczta.XXXXXXXXXXX promet

   
Quote
(@stefanodavid)
Joined: 3 years ago
Posts: 227
 

@dart This seems a problem with memcached. Can you check whether it is running/configured correctly?


   
ReplyQuote
 dart
(@dart)
Joined: 1 year ago
Posts: 11
Topic starter  

not now, but it is production server :> but it is clue... Now, in 23.10.0 everything works, but memcached listens at:

LISTEN     0      1024             127.0.1.1:11211             0.0.0.0:*     users:(("memcached",pid=15517,fd=22))

But in 23.11.0 it try to connect to interface IP address:

lis 26 14:05:02 poczta.zeto.lublin.pl carbonio-files[12542]: java.io.IOException: Connect to 10.0.60.24:11211 fail,Connection refused

But there's something else strange. It refers to carbonio-files, but i don't use to `files`. It means, carbonioFeatureFilesEnabled is `false` for all COS. Hmm....


   
ReplyQuote
 dart
(@dart)
Joined: 1 year ago
Posts: 11
Topic starter  

hello,

And have somebody similar problem? Yesterday I tried upgrade again, but before it I set `carbonio prov ms `zmhostname` zimbraMemcachedBindAddress 10.0.60.24`, that memcached listen on IP interface, in stead of `lo` (I checked it). But after upgrade, situation is this same 🙁


   
ReplyQuote